Introduction: In recent years, the e-commerce industry has taken the retail world by storm. With its convenience and accessibility, online shopping has become the preferred method of purchasing goods for many consumers. This trend is particularly prominent in the grocery and household products sector, as more Americans are opting to have their everyday essentials delivered right to their doorstep. However, it's not just convenience that makes e-commerce appealing. Many online retailers are also focusing on promoting social responsibility in this industry, ensuring that their practices contribute to a better future for our planet and society. 1. Sustainable Packaging: One of the most significant ways in which e-commerce is fostering social responsibility in the grocery and household products sector is through sustainable packaging. Traditional brick-and-mortar stores often rely on excessive packaging, contributing to unnecessary waste. In contrast, online retailers are adopting practices to minimize packaging materials, opting for more eco-friendly alternatives. By utilizing recyclable and biodegradable packaging materials, e-commerce companies are reducing their carbon footprint and encouraging customers to do the same. 2. Ethical Supply Chains: Another crucial aspect of social responsibility in the grocery and household products industry is ethical sourcing and supply chains. With e-commerce, consumers have become more conscious about the origins of their purchased goods and expect retailers to prioritize fair trade practices. Online retailers are increasingly partnering with suppliers who adhere to ethical standards, ensuring that the products they offer are sourced responsibly and that workers are treated fairly. By promoting transparency and accountability, e-commerce companies are empowering consumers to make informed purchasing decisions. 3. Supporting Local and Independent Brands: In addition to promoting sustainable and ethical practices, e-commerce platforms are also helping to uplift local and independent brands within the grocery and household products industry. Traditional retail tends to favor larger, well-known brands, making it challenging for smaller businesses to compete. However, online platforms have made it easier for independent brands to gain visibility and reach a broader audience. By supporting local and independent brands, e-commerce provides consumers with a more diverse range of products while bolstering the growth of smaller businesses, contributing to a more sustainable and diverse market. 4. Donation Programs and Charitable Initiatives: Social responsibility in the e-commerce industry extends beyond the products themselves. Many online retailers have implemented donation programs and charitable initiatives to make a positive impact on society. By partnering with non-profit organizations and local charities, e-commerce companies can donate a portion of their profits or take part in community service projects. These initiatives not only benefit society but also create a sense of goodwill among consumers, as they can contribute to positive change simply by making a purchase online. Conclusion: As e-commerce continues to reshape the retail landscape, the grocery and household products industry in the USA is embracing social responsibility in various ways. From sustainable packaging to ethical sourcing and supporting local brands, online retailers are making a positive impact. By prioritizing environmentally friendly practices, fair trade, and charitable initiatives, e-commerce companies are not only meeting consumer demands but also leading the way toward a more sustainable and socially conscious future.
